HTML <a> referrerpolicy Attribut

Definition und Verwendung

referrerpolicy Das Attribut legt fest, welche Referrer-Informationen (Referenzinformationen) gesendet werden sollen, wenn der Benutzer auf einen Hyperlink klickt.

Beispiel

Referrerpolicy für Links festlegen:

<a href="https://www.codew3c.com" referrerpolicy="origin">

Syntax

<a referrerpolicy="no-referrer|no-referrer-when-downgrade|origin|origin-when-cross-origin|same-origin|strict-origin-when-cross-origin|unsafe-url">

Attributwert

Wert Beschreibung
no-referrer Keine Referenzinformationen senden.
no-referrer-when-downgrade Standard. Wenn die Sicherheitsstufe des Protokolls unverändert bleibt oder höher ist (von HTTP zu HTTP, von HTTPS zu HTTPS, von HTTP zu HTTPS ist ebenfalls möglich), werden die Herkunft, der Pfad und der Query-String gesendet. Keine Inhalte werden an Sicherheitsstufen mit niedrigerem Rang gesendet (von HTTPS zu HTTP ist nicht erlaubt).
origin Senden Sie die Quelle des Dokuments (Protokoll, Host und Port).
origin-when-cross-origin Für Anfragen von anderen Quellen wird die Quelle des Dokuments gesendet. Für Anfragen von derselben Quelle werden Quelle, Pfad und Query-String gesendet.
same-origin Für Anfragen von derselben Quelle wird Referenzseiteninformation gesendet. Für Anfragen von anderen Quellen wird keine Referenzseiteninformation gesendet.
strict-origin-when-cross-origin Wenn die Sicherheitsstufe des Protokolls unverändert bleibt oder höher ist (von HTTP zu HTTP, von HTTPS zu HTTPS sowie von HTTP zu HTTPS), wird die Quelle gesendet. Für weniger sichere Stufen (von HTTPS zu HTTP) wird nichts gesendet.
unsafe-url Senden Sie die Quelle, den Pfad und den Query-String (ohne Sicherheit zu berücksichtigen). Verwenden Sie diesen Wert mit Vorsicht!

Browser-Unterstützung

Die in der Tabelle genannten Zahlen geben die erste Version des Browsers an, die diese Eigenschaft vollständig unterstützt.

Chrome Edge Firefox Safari Opera
Chrome Edge Firefox Safari Opera
51.0 79.0 50.0 11.1 38.0